- StarsLarry SemonOliver ThorndikeParker McCormickSuspense/Anthology series based on an ABC radio series which ran from 1946-48. The half-hour series mostly consisted of original dramas concerning murder, mayhem or insanity. Series narrator Larry Semon was the only regular; each week a new set of actors were featured. The title of the series was derived from a clock which was major plot element in each story. The show's musical theme was "The Sands of Time."

- StarsJoseph N. WelchRobert FlemyngLouis EdmondsThe Dow Hour of Great Mysteries, was a series of seven television specials from March to November 1960, hosted by Joseph Welch on NBC, and sponsored by Dow Chemical. Welch died on October 6, 1960, bringing the series to an end.
